Geographic Analysis of Professional Baseball's First-year Player Signings, 1965-1977
Abstract
This project was initiated in December, 1977 when Dr. John F. Rooney handed me a carton of papers dealing with contemporary professional baseball player signings. My original plan was to analyze only a portion of the data for a paper to be presented the following April at the annual meeting of the Association of American Geographers. I became so engrossed with the subject that I soon decided to thoroughly examine the entire data set for a masters thesis. A two-month tour of many of the major league ballparks during the summer of 1978 further aroused my curiosity for the subject. The intertwining of baseball and geography has since become a personal labor of love. It is hoped that others might find this thesis interesting and informative.
